Drag Race star Gia Gunn calls coronavirus "a hoax"

RuPaul's Drag Race star Gia Gunn claims that the coronavirus is a hoax and the population are being "brainwashed".

RuPaul's Drag Race star Gia Gunn has courted controversy by sharing her theory that the coronavirus pandemic is "a hoax".

In a live stream on Instagram which has since gone viral on Twitter, the season six star appears to suggest that the deadly disease is a government ruse that has left people "brainwashed".

"I think the whole mask thing is ridiculous," she said. "I honestly think this whole COVID-19 thing is a hoax. I think everybody that is taking precautions is cute and it's definitely the thing to do but I also think that a lot of people are brainwashed.

"I think the more and more and more that we look around and see each other with masks on, the more influenced that we are going to be to also put our masks on. Which then, to me, insinuates to me that things are not okay.

"I'm here to tell you guys that I think things are more okay than what the government is allowing us to think."

Almost half a million people worldwide have now died from coronavirus, including over 127,000 in the US - comfortably the highest death toll of any country in the world.
